Guam Army National Guard Public Address and Lighting Lifecycle Replacement
Solicitation # W911YU26QA014
Solicitation W911YU26QA014 is a single-award, firm-fixed-price supply contract issued by the United States Property and Fiscal Office for Guam to provide a Public Address and Lighting Lifecycle Replacement for the Guam Army National Guard 721st Army Band. The requirement consists of brand new, non-refurbished audio-visual equipment, including Chauvet lighting fixtures, QSC speakers, microphones, and Gator rack cases. This procurement is a 100% set-aside for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B) under NAICS code 423690, with a size standard of 250 employees. The contract will be awarded based on the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) process, where offerors are first evaluated on technical acceptability and then on price reasonableness and balance. All equipment must meet specific salient characteristics and include standard manufacturer warranties. Delivery is required by December 31, 2026, with the contractor responsible for all transportation costs to the destination in Barrigada, Guam. High-value items and specific components must comply with MIL-STD-130 and MIL-STD-129 for unique item identification and marking. Quotations must be submitted electronically via the Procurement Integrated Enterprise Environment (PIEE) portal. While the original closing date was September 18, 2026, Amendment 0002 extended the response deadline to September 25, 2026, at 3:00 PM ChST. Invoicing and payment will be processed through the Wide Area WorkFlow (WAWF) system. The solicitation inc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and specific cybersecurity reporting requirements.

The Department of National Defence is seeking spare parts, cables, and RTU licenses for an existing platform originally developed by Nokia Canada Inc., the sole owner of the underlying intellectual property, under a set-aside procurement designated for only one supplier due to technical and IP constraints. This solicitation, issued as an Advance Contract Award Notice (ACAN) under number W6369-260487/A, requires suppliers to submit a statement of capabilities demonstrating full compliance with the listed technical specifications, including precise part numbers and quantities for items such as GNSS, L2/L3 VPN, MACSEC port licenses, DCE and Sync Y-cables, RS232 distribution panels, power converter pigtails, and LTE antennas—all bearing the NCAGE code A036G. No substitutions are permitted, and all goods must be delivered by August 31, 2026, to the specified location at 285 Coventry Road, Cubicle 4B19, Ottawa, ON K1K 3X6. Bids must be submitted electronically by June 29, 2026, at 14:00 EDT to the designated email address, with no hard copies accepted. If no qualified bidder meets the minimum essential requirements, the award will default to Nokia Canada Inc. as the pre-identified supplier. All quoted prices must include Canadian customs duties, GST/HST, and excise taxes, with GST/HST shown separately, and goods must be delivered Delivery Duty Paid, covering all freight and charges to the destination. The estimated contract value is $91,852.00, excluding taxes. Ownership of any foreground intellectual property developed under this procurement vests with the contractor, and submissions may be made in either English or French.

NOTICE OF PROPOSED PROCUREMENT Note: Bidders are to transmit their bids electronically using the method indicated on the cover page of the Advance Contract Notice Award as opposed to delivery usually available. To provide spare parts for an existing platform, originally developed by the OEM and awarded through a competitive process under Contract No. W8474-126058.The Department of National Defence has a requirement for the items detailed below. The delivery is requested to Department of National Defence 285 Coventry Road Cubicle 4B19 Ottawa ON K1K 3X6 by August 31, 2026. GSIN: 5995 - RTU - IXR GNSS License Part No.: 3HE11913AA, NCAGE: A036G, Quantity: 2,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 - L2 VPN License, per UNI 100G IXR port Part No.: 3HE11915AA, NCAGE: A036G, Quantity: 2,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 - L3 VPN License, per UNI 100G IXR port Part No.: 3HE11916AA, NCAGE: A036G, Quantity: 2,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 - RTU - 10GE MACSEC Port Part No.: 3HE18937AA, NCAGE: A036G, Quantity: 4,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 - RTU - 100GE MACSEC Port Part No.: 3HE18940AA, NCAGE: A036G, Quantity: 4,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 – RTU 7250 1588 Freq+Phase Licence Large, Part No.: 3HE16839A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 7 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 – RTU – 1GE MACSEC Port, Part No. : 3HE18936A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 14 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N: 5995 – DCE Cable for SDI V3, Part NO.: 3HE12410A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 20 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N 5995 – Sync Y-Cable Part No.: 3HE03401A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 50 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N 5995 – 4 Port RS232 Dist Panel, SDIv3 only, Part No.: 3HE12442A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 20 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N 5595 - 7705 AC Power Converter Pigtail - O-ring, Part No.: 3HE05837BA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 6 Unit of Issue: EA GSIN 5595 - SAR-Hm/Hmc Antenna Indoor LTE (omni), Part No.: 3HE12371AA, NCAGE: A036G Quantity: 12 Unit of Issue: EA The Crown retains the rights to negotiate with suppliers on any procurement. Documents may be submitted in either official language of Canada.
